Beta-Endorphin is a naturally occurring [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Opioid_peptide#:~:text=Opioid%20peptides%20are%20peptides%20that,all%20resemble%20those%20of%20opiates. opioid neuropeptide] found in Humans and animals. It is the primary ligand of the [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/%CE%9C-opioid_receptor mu-opioid receptors] in the brain which is the same receptors fully agonised by [[Morphine]], [[Heroin]], [[Fentanyl]], and other [[Opioids|opioid]] drugs.
